About St. John's College

St. John's College is a private, non-profit four-year institution located in Annapolis, Maryland. With an enrollment of approximately 488 undergraduate students, it is a small institution. The university admits 44% of applicants, making it moderately selective. The graduation rate stands at a strong 72%. Graduates earn a median salary of $51,584 within 10 years of enrollment. After financial aid, the average student pays a net price of $27,934 per year.
